The Environmental, Health & Safety Manager (EHS) role at O-I's Glass Manufacturing Plant is a strategic partner that integrates EH&S into site culture, leading all phases of the plant’s environmental, health, and safety programs.
Requirements
- Advise site management regarding the establishment of Environmental, Health & Safety objectives
- Maintain accurate and complete records that meet regulatory requirements
- Evaluate the effectiveness of existing E,H&S programs
- Measure, audit and evaluate the effectiveness of hazard controls and hazard control programs
- Develop hazard control designs, methods, procedures and programs
- Act as the site contact for Worker’s Compensation issues
- Coach and mentor plant leadership/supervisors in identifying hazards and the proper interaction with employees to discuss safety behavior (Tell Me process)
- Implement, administer and advise others on hazard controls and hazard control programs
- Participate in state and federal OSHA inspections
- Coordinate the plant accident and investigation program, including the maintenance of required OSHA reports
- Conduct mandated employee health and safety training programs
- Assist Regional EH&S staff in the quantification, evaluation and control of employee exposure to potential occupational health hazards
